Hey there! If you're looking to pick out some fabric testing instruments in 2023, it’s super important to wrap your head around the different regulatory standards that pop up in various regions. Trust me, sticking to these standards not only keeps your fabrics safe and high-quality, but it also opens up the market for you. For example, over in the European Union, they’ve got this REACH regulation that requires specific testing for chemicals in textiles. Meanwhile, in the good ol' U.S., the ASTM standards are the ones setting the bar for things like flammability and durability. Knowing these rules is key if you’re a manufacturer who wants to avoid those pesky penalties and keep things in line.
Here's a little tip for you: keep an eye on the regional regulations because they can change! Establishing a routine to check out the latest industry standards can really help you fine-tune your testing processes as needed.
And let's not forget, the testing instruments you choose can make a world of difference in meeting these regulatory demands. High-tech fabric testing gear will give you accurate assessments of critical performance traits like tensile strength, colorfastness, and shrinkage. So, yeah, investing in quality instruments not only keeps you compliant but also boosts your product’s reliability in this competitive market.
Oh, and one more tip: look for manufacturers that provide calibration services and ongoing support. This way, you can rest easy knowing your testing instruments will stay compliant with the latest standards, which means you’ll get consistent and reliable results every time.
